As the name suggests, Shudan tablets have the main function of clearing the bile duct and promoting bile to enter the corresponding digestive parts. In addition, Shudan tablets also help to expel stones in the gallbladder. Patients with cholecystitis and some bile tract infections can take this medicine. In addition, bile in the human body itself has a disinfecting and bactericidal effect, so taking this medicine can enhance the body's antibacterial ability. Function and indications Clears away heat and dampness, promotes bile secretion and removes stones, promotes qi circulation and relieves pain. It is used for damp-heat in the liver and gallbladder, jaundice, side pain, fever, bitter taste in the mouth, red urine and dry stool; cholecystitis, biliary tract infection, and cholelithiasis with the above symptoms. Usage and Dosage Oral administration, 5 to 6 tablets at a time, 3 times a day. For children, reduce the dosage appropriately or follow the doctor's advice. Note: Pregnant women should not take this medicine. Preparation method For the above nine ingredients, take half amount of rhubarb and grind it into fine powder along with Polygonum cuspidatum and Glauber's salt. Take costus root and fructus aurantii and distill them by steam distillation, collect an appropriate amount of distillate and set aside. Mix the dregs with Magnolia officinalis, Curcuma aromatica, Gardenia jasminoides, Artemisia capillaris and half amount of rhubarb, add water and boil for three times, the first time for 2 hours, the second time for 1.5 hours and the third time for 1 hour, combine the decoctions, filter, let stand for 2-4 hours, filter out the supernatant, concentrate to a thick paste with a relative density of 1.30-1.35 (80°C), mix with the above powder, dry, crush, add appropriate amount of starch to granulate, dry, spray the above distillate, mix, press into 1000 tablets, and coat. Characteristics This product is a sugar-coated tablet, which appears brown after removing the sugar coating; it tastes bitter and slightly astringent. Identification (1) Take this product and observe it under a microscope: the stone cells are spherical, kidney-shaped or triangular, with dense pores; sometimes 2 to 3 branched stone cells can be seen connected, in the shape of a spindle, rectangular or elongated into fibers, with many branches, pores and grooves of varying density, and starch grains in the cell cavity. (2) Take 5 tablets of this product, remove the sugar coating, grind them into powder, add 30 ml of methanol, heat in a water bath for 30 minutes, filter, evaporate the filtrate to dryness, add 20 ml of water to dissolve, add 4 ml of hydrochloric acid, reflux in a water bath for 30 minutes, cool immediately, extract twice with ether, 25 ml each time, combine the ether extracts, evaporate the ether, add 2 ml of chloroform to dissolve, and use this as the test solution. Take another rhubarb reference medicinal material and prepare a reference medicinal material solution in the same way; then take chrysophanol and rhamnolide reference substances, add methanol to prepare a mixed solution containing 0.5 mg of each per 1 ml, as the reference substance solution. According to the thin layer chromatography method (Appendix Ⅵ B), 3 μl of each of the three solutions mentioned above were respectively spotted on the same silica gel G thin layer plate, and petroleum ether (30-60°C)-ethyl formate-formic acid (15:5:1) was used as the developing agent. After development, the plate was taken out, dried, and examined under ultraviolet light (365 nm). In the chromatogram of the test sample, the same orange fluorescent spot appears at the position corresponding to the chromatogram of the reference medicinal material and the reference sample. After being fumigated in ammonia gas, the spot turns red. (3) Take 5 tablets of this product, remove the sugar coating, grind them into powder, add 20 ml of ether, shake for 10 minutes, discard the ether, evaporate to dryness, add 20 ml of ethyl acetate to the residue, heat and reflux for 1 hour, take out, cool, filter, evaporate the filtrate to dryness, add 1 ml of methanol to the residue to dissolve it, and use it as the test solution. Take another reference substance of Gardenia jasminoides and add methanol to prepare a solution containing 1 mg per 1 ml as the reference substance solution. According to the thin layer chromatography method (Appendix Ⅵ B), 5 μl of each of the above two solutions were taken and spotted on the same silica gel G thin layer plate, and ethyl acetate-acetone-formic acid-water (10:6:2:0.5) was used as the developing solvent. After development, the plate was taken out, dried, sprayed with 10% ethanolic sulfuric acid solution, and baked at 105°C for about 10 minutes. In the chromatogram of the test sample, a spot of the same color appears at the corresponding position in the chromatogram of the reference sample. |
